In the pulsating encounter that took place on 18th February 2024 as part of the Ligue 1 competition, the home team Montpellier proved to be the dominant team, besting Metz in a 3-0 win. This match was an exhibition of Montpellier's offensive prowess and collective teamwork, which significantly impacted the match outcome.

Montpellier's strategic play was evident from the early minutes of the game as they scored their first goal only 2 minutes and 57 seconds into the first half. The home team continued this pressure in the second half, scoring at the 49th and 85th minute marker respectively. The nimble offensive strategy of Montpellier was clearly a decisive factor in the match, which kept the Metz defense on their toes, leaving them with little opportunity to initiate a counter-attack.

The home team exhibited great control of the game, as indicated by the seven corner kicks they were allotted as compared to only four for Metz. The disparity in the corner kicks accentuates Montpellier's domination in ball possession and territorial advantage.

In terms of discipline, both teams were at par with each other, receiving three yellow cards each. However, Montpellier received most of their cards during the first half whereas Metz received all their cards in the second half, showing a possible inference that Metz's frustration increased as the match progressed, indicating loss of composure as Montpellier stretched their lead.

The fouling pattern was slightly higher for Montpellier, committing 16 fouls in contrast to 13 from Metz. This suggests a highly aggressive and physical style of play from the home team to maintain a grip on the game. Furthermore, Montpellier was called offside four times, indicating their assertive forward strategy, while Metz was only caught offside once, further highlighting their more defensive posture.

In essence, with a hat trick of solid goals and control of the ball for most of the game, Montpellier managed to keep their opponents at bay. Their dominating and aggressive style of play was central to their victory over Metz.

In conclusion, the match statistics clearly outline Montpellier’s superiority both in terms of operational efficiency as well as strategic positioning. A combination of early goals, increased ball possession, and a defensively robust yet offensively active strategy led Montpellier to a gratifying 3-0 victory over Metz.
